All original (large) versions of the Super Nintendo and Super Famicom (NTSC & PAL) can output RGB without a modification, however each region requires a different cable. Aug 19, 2024 · If you connect a CSYNC cable to a PAL SNES, you can damage your equipment! Instead, you can use a cable that gets sync from luma (pin 7) or composite video (pin 9) on the multi-out connector (luma recommended). boards. The c sync pass through one. Jul 25, 2019 · You couldn't even use an NTSC SNES/SFC with a PAL SNES PSU, not only because of the plug differences, but also because the PAL SNES uses AC, whilst the NTSC SNES/SFC use DC. RGB Cable Components NTSC All RGB cables that use CSYNC should have a 330-450 ohm resistor on the CSYNC line. SNES Super Nintendo / Super Famicom All original (large) versions of the Super Nintendo and Super Famicom (NTSC & PAL) can output RGB without a modification – All that’s required is the proper cable. I tried this cable on both a 1Chip-02 (1995) and 2Chip (1993) SNES and they work flawlessly. . Super Nintendo (PAL) – PAL SNES’ have 12v on pin 3 of the mulit-out, NOT csync!!!! If you connect a csync cable to a PAL SNES, yu can damage your equipment!!! 75 ohm rated Mini-coax Retro Access Mini-Coax SCART cables feature 75 ohm rated coaxial conductors, built to the same ultra-high quality standards that studio professionals rely on. For RGB modded N64s, Sync on Luma is the recommended alternative as CSync is sometimes not connected in basic RGB mods. requires a modification to get RGB, but it can result in really high quality video output. In most scenarios, the best RGB cables to use with PAL SNES systems are either the basic-shielded cables that get sync from the luma pin, or fully shielded that get sync from cvbs (composite video).
